This is a high-impact, “road warrior”,
systems-super-user role that floats across Patriot/AVW operating locations to ensure uninterrupted dispatch execution,
data accuracy
, and service continuity.
The Operations Dispatch Specialist serves as a hands-on expert in both dispatch/ERP platforms (
TRUX and Tower
), stepping in to run dispatch when local coverage is limited and elevating performance by standardizing best practices, coaching teams, and tightening daily execution. The role is highly mobile (routine overnight travel) and requires advanced proficiency in Microsoft Excel and strong working skills with Word, PowerPoint, and Outlook
.
- 1) Dispatch coverage & operational continuity
- Provide on-site and remote dispatch coverage across all assigned locations to cover vacations, absences, training gaps, peak demand, special projects, and operational disruptions.
- Lead daily “crew-out” and “crew-in” execution: confirm staffing, assign trucks/routes, manage call-offs, coordinate helpers, and adjust plans in real time to protect service.
- Serve as the central communication hub between drivers, supervisors, customer service, disposal facilities, maintenance, and leadership while assigned to a location.
- Manage residential, commercial, roll-off, and special/bulk/delivery operations as applicable by site; prioritize safety, compliance, and customer commitments.
- Operate as an expert-level user in both TRUX and Tower
: routing/dispatch center operations, work order scheduling, route completion, ticketing, and daily closeout. - Perform accurate route close and productivity entry (times, odometers, driver/helper assignments, route completion summaries).
- Enter and reconcile disposal information (facility, ticket numbers, material, tons), ensuring accurate reporting and timely closeout.
- Manage work orders end-to-end: validate customer status/credit holds, schedule call-ins appropriately, print/schedule work orders by cut-off times, and coordinate confirmation with route leadership.
- Troubleshoot system issues, identify data defects, and partner with IT/operations to correct root causes; document repeatable fixes and job aids.
- 3) Documentation, compliance, and control
- Maintain strict documentation control for tickets, logs, receipts, and required route paperwork; ensure proper handoff to accounting/other departments.
- Support DOT/HOS compliance and site policy adherence through dispatch decisions, escalation, and consistent documentation.
- Ensure DVIR and safety-critical paperwork is captured, routed to maintenance, and tracked to closure.
- Support telematics/driver-truck associations and operational systems that rely on accurate dispatcher inputs.
- 4) Reporting, analytics, and communication
- Own daily and weekly operational reporting outputs tied to dispatch accuracy and service performance (missed stops, bulk/missed route lists, disposal summaries, productivity checks, exception reports).
- Use Excel at an advanced level (filters, pivot tables, lookups, data validation, conditional formatting, structured tables) to maintain schedules, track performance, and detect key-entry errors.
- Create clear communications and recap packages for leaders and cross-functional teams using Outlook and PowerPoint.
- Maintain and update shared trackers and standardized dispatch artifacts (shared drives/SharePoint/Teams files, daily snapshots, route cover sheets, exception sheets).
- 5) Standardization, coaching, and continuous improvement
- Implement and reinforce standardized dispatch procedures across locations; quickly learn each site’s nuances while protecting core standards.
- Coach and mentor local dispatchers and supervisors on best practices in TRUX/Tower usage, troubleshooting, and dispatch decision-making.
- Identify recurring gaps (training, process, system settings) and recommend improvements that reduce missed service, rework, and data errors.
